Top 10 Database Administration Tools: Features, Pros, Cons & Comparison

Uncategorized
BEST COSMETIC HOSPITALS โ€ข CURATED PICKS

Find the Best Cosmetic Hospitals โ€” Choose with Confidence

Discover top cosmetic hospitals in one place and take the next step toward the look youโ€™ve been dreaming of.

โ€œYour confidence is your power โ€” invest in yourself, and let your best self shine.โ€

Explore BestCosmeticHospitals.com

Compare โ€ข Shortlist โ€ข Decide smarter โ€” works great on mobile too.

Table of Contents

Introduction

Database Administration Tools are software solutions that help database administrators (DBAs) manage, maintain, and optimize databases effectively. These tools streamline tasks such as database configuration, user management, backup and recovery, performance tuning, and security enforcement. With the increasing complexity of cloud and hybrid database environments, efficient database administration is critical for ensuring uptime, performance, and data integrity.

Real-world use cases include managing SQL Server, Oracle, MySQL, and PostgreSQL databases; automating backup and restore operations; monitoring performance and query optimization; enforcing security policies and access controls; and integrating with cloud-based database services. Effective administration ensures regulatory compliance, operational efficiency, and high availability.

Evaluation criteria for buyers include database type support, automation capabilities, backup and recovery management, performance monitoring, user and access management, scalability, integration with cloud and DevOps pipelines, security compliance, ease of use, and cost efficiency.

Best for: enterprises, SMBs, cloud-native organizations, DBAs, DevOps teams, and IT operations teams managing multiple databases.
Not ideal for: very small teams or organizations using only managed database services where administration is largely automated.


Key Trends in Database Administration Tools

  • Automation of backup, recovery, and maintenance tasks.
  • Cloud-native and hybrid database administration solutions.
  • Integration with DevOps pipelines and CI/CD workflows.
  • Real-time performance monitoring and query optimization.
  • Role-based access and security enforcement.
  • Support for SQL, NoSQL, and multi-cloud databases.
  • AI/ML-powered recommendations for performance tuning.
  • Subscription and SaaS-based pricing models for SMB adoption.
  • Focus on compliance: GDPR, HIPAA, SOC 2, ISO 27001.
  • Multi-database management and centralized dashboards.

How We Selected These Tools (Methodology)

  • Evaluated market adoption and popularity across enterprises and SMBs.
  • Assessed feature completeness: backup, recovery, monitoring, user management.
  • Reviewed reliability, scalability, and performance metrics.
  • Examined integration with DevOps, cloud services, and ITSM tools.
  • Considered security posture and compliance certifications.
  • Evaluated ease of use and administrative efficiency.
  • Prioritized multi-database and hybrid/cloud support.
  • Focused on tools with automation, performance optimization, and reporting.

Top 10 Database Administration Tools

#1 โ€” SQL Server Management Studio (SSMS)

Short description: SSMS is a free, Microsoft-provided tool for managing SQL Server databases. It simplifies administration tasks such as query execution, backup, configuration, and performance monitoring.

Key Features

  • Graphical interface for SQL Server administration.
  • Query editor with syntax highlighting.
  • Database backup, restore, and configuration management.
  • Performance and activity monitoring.
  • Integration with Azure SQL databases.

Pros

  • Free and widely used in Microsoft environments.
  • Comprehensive administration and management features.

Cons

  • Limited to SQL Server.
  • Cloud-native automation features are basic.

Platforms / Deployment

  • Windows / Cloud
  • On-premises / Cloud

Security & Compliance

  • Role-based access control
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• Azure SQL
  • PowerShell and scripting automation
  • SQL Server Agent for scheduling tasks

Support & Community

  • Microsoft support, extensive documentation, active community forums.

#2 โ€” Oracle SQL Developer

Short description: Oracle SQL Developer is a free integrated development environment (IDE) for Oracle databases, offering administration, development, and query management in a single tool.

Key Features

  • Database browsing and query execution.
  • Backup and restore management.
  • Performance monitoring and tuning advisor.
  • Data modeling and reporting.
  • Integration with Oracle Cloud and on-prem databases.

Pros

  • Free and feature-rich for Oracle DBAs.
  • Supports development and administration tasks in one tool.

Cons

  • Primarily for Oracle databases.
  • Advanced enterprise management may require additional tools.

Platforms / Deployment

  • Windows / macOS / Linux
  • Cloud / On-premises

Security & Compliance

  • Role-based access control
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• Oracle Cloud services
  • SQL scripts and PL/SQL integration
  • Data modeling and reporting tools

Support & Community

  • Oracle documentation, forums, and enterprise support options.

#3 โ€” Toad for Oracle

Short description: Toad is a commercial tool for Oracle database management, offering administration, development, and performance optimization capabilities for enterprises.

Key Features

  • Database administration and user management.
  • Query optimization and performance monitoring.
  • Backup and recovery tools.
  • Automation of repetitive administrative tasks.
  • Integration with DevOps and CI/CD pipelines.

Pros

  • Comprehensive enterprise features.
  • Simplifies routine DBA tasks.

Cons

  • Licensing costs for SMBs.
  • Complexity may require training.

Platforms / Deployment

  • Windows
  • On-premises / Cloud

Security & Compliance

  • AES encryption for sensitive data
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• Oracle Cloud and on-premises
  • SQL scripts and PL/SQL automation
  • ITSM and DevOps pipelines

Support & Community

  • Vendor support, knowledge base, and professional services.

#4 โ€” Navicat Premium

Short description: Navicat Premium is a multi-database administration tool supporting MySQL, SQL Server, Oracle, PostgreSQL, and SQLite, offering management, development, and data migration features.

Key Features

  • Multi-database support in a single tool.
  • Data modeling, query building, and reporting.
  • Backup, restore, and scheduling automation.
  • Data synchronization and migration.
  • Cloud database support.

Pros

  • Multi-database administration in one interface.
  • User-friendly and visually intuitive.

Cons

  • Subscription-based pricing.
  • May be less powerful for large enterprise deployments.

Platforms / Deployment

  • Windows / macOS / Linux / Cloud
  • On-premises / Cloud

Security & Compliance

  • SSL/TLS encryption for connections
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• Cloud services (AWS, Azure, GCP)
  • SQL and database connectors
  • Data migration and synchronization tools

Support & Community

  • Vendor support, documentation, and user community.

#5 โ€” DBArtisan

Short description: DBArtisan is a multi-platform database administration tool offering performance monitoring, configuration management, and maintenance for relational databases.

Key Features

  • Multi-database support (Oracle, SQL Server, MySQL, DB2).
  • Performance tuning and query analysis.
  • Backup and recovery management.
  • Schema and user management.
  • Reporting and compliance support.

Pros

  • Multi-database administration in a single interface.
  • Enterprise-grade features for DBAs.

Cons

  • Licensing costs.
  • May be complex for small teams.

Platforms / Deployment

  • Windows
  • On-premises / Hybrid

Security & Compliance

  • AES encryption
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• ITSM tools
  • Cloud database connections
  • Reporting and analytics tools

Support & Community

  • Vendor support, documentation, and forums.

#6 โ€” phpMyAdmin

Short description: phpMyAdmin is a free, open-source web-based administration tool for MySQL and MariaDB databases, simplifying management and query execution.

Key Features

  • Web-based database administration.
  • Query execution and schema management.
  • Backup and restore functions.
  • User and access management.
  • Data import/export support.

Pros

  • Free and easy to deploy.
  • Web-based access for remote administration.

Cons

  • Limited to MySQL/MariaDB.
  • Fewer enterprise automation features.

Platforms / Deployment

  • Web / Linux / Windows
  • On-premises / Cloud

Security & Compliance

  • SSL/TLS support for connections
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• Web servers (Apache, Nginx)
  • Cloud MySQL instances
  • APIs for automation

Support & Community

  • Open-source community support and forums.

#7 โ€” Oracle Enterprise Manager

Short description: Oracle Enterprise Manager provides comprehensive administration, performance monitoring, and lifecycle management for Oracle databases and applications.

Key Features

  • Database administration and performance monitoring.
  • Backup, recovery, and patch management.
  • Configuration and user management.
  • Integration with Oracle Cloud and on-premises systems.
  • Compliance and auditing reporting.

Pros

  • Enterprise-grade Oracle management.
  • Centralized administration and monitoring.

Cons

  • Enterprise pricing and complexity.
  • Limited to Oracle environments.

Platforms / Deployment

  • Windows / Linux / Cloud
  • On-premises / Hybrid / Cloud

Security & Compliance

  • AES encryption
  • ISO 27001, SOC 2

Integrations & Ecosystem

  • Oracle Cloud and databases
  • DevOps pipelines
  • ITSM integration

Support & Community

  • Vendor support and professional services.

#8 โ€” Navicat Essentials

Short description: Navicat Essentials is a lightweight version of Navicat for database administration, supporting single database types with simplified administration and development tools.

Key Features

  • Database management for single platforms.
  • Backup, restore, and data import/export.
  • Query builder and execution.
  • Simple reporting.
  • Cross-platform support.

Pros

  • Affordable and easy to use.
  • Ideal for SMBs or single-database environments.

Cons

  • Limited multi-database support.
  • Fewer advanced features compared to full Navicat Premium.

Platforms / Deployment

  • Windows / macOS / Linux
  • On-premises / Cloud

Security & Compliance

  • SSL/TLS encryption
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• Cloud databases
  • SQL connectors
  • APIs

Support & Community

  • Vendor support, documentation.

#9 โ€” Aqua Data Studio

Short description: Aqua Data Studio provides database administration, query development, and visual analytics for multiple databases including SQL, Oracle, MySQL, and PostgreSQL.

Key Features

  • Multi-database administration.
  • Visual query builder and data analytics.
  • Backup, restore, and migration support.
  • Performance monitoring.
  • Reporting and visualization dashboards.

Pros

  • Supports multiple database platforms.
  • Integrated development and administration tools.

Cons

  • Licensing cost may be high for SMBs.
  • Advanced features require training.

Platforms / Deployment

  • Windows / macOS / Linux
  • On-premises / Cloud

Security & Compliance

  • SSL/TLS encryption
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• Cloud database instances
  • DevOps tools
  • SQL connectors

Support & Community

  • Vendor support and knowledge base.

#10 โ€” DBeaver

Short description: DBeaver is an open-source, multi-platform database administration tool supporting SQL, NoSQL, and cloud databases for developers and DBAs.

Key Features

  • SQL editor and query execution.
  • Multi-database support.
  • Backup, restore, and schema management.
  • Visualization and reporting.
  • Cloud database integration.

Pros

  • Free and open-source.
  • Supports multiple databases and platforms.

Cons

  • Lacks enterprise automation features.
  • Community support may be limited for complex issues.

Platforms / Deployment

  • Windows / macOS / Linux / Cloud
  • On-premises / Cloud

Security & Compliance

  • SSL/TLS connections
  • Not publicly stated for SOC 2

Integrations & Ecosystem

  • AWS, Azure, GCP
  • SQL connectors and scripts
  • APIs for automation

Support & Community

  • Open-source community and documentation.

Comparison Table (Top 10)

Tool NameBest ForPlatform(s) SupportedDeploymentStandout FeaturePublic Rating
SQL Server Management StudioSQL ServerWindows / CloudOn-prem / CloudQuery execution & administrationN/A
Oracle SQL DeveloperOracleWindows / macOS / LinuxCloud / On-premDevelopment & administrationN/A
Toad for OracleOracleWindowsOn-prem / CloudEnterprise administrationN/A
Navicat PremiumMulti-databaseWindows / macOS / Linux / CloudOn-prem / CloudMulti-database supportN/A
DBArtisanMulti-databaseWindowsOn-prem / HybridPerformance tuningN/A
phpMyAdminMySQL / MariaDBWeb / Linux / WindowsOn-prem / CloudWeb-based managementN/A
Oracle Enterprise ManagerOracleWindows / Linux / CloudOn-prem / Hybrid / CloudCentralized monitoring & administrationN/A
Navicat EssentialsSingle databaseWindows / macOS / LinuxOn-prem / CloudLightweight adminN/A
Aqua Data StudioMulti-databaseWindows / macOS / LinuxOn-prem / CloudVisual analytics & administrationN/A
DBeaverMulti-databaseWindows / macOS / Linux / CloudOn-prem / CloudOpen-source multi-platformN/A

Evaluation & Scoring of Database Administration Tools

Tool NameCore (25%)Ease (15%)Integrations (15%)Security (10%)Performance (10%)Support (10%)Value (15%)Weighted Total
SSMS98788898.3
Oracle SQL Developer97788798.1
Toad for Oracle97788788.0
Navicat Premium88787787.8
DBArtisan87788777.7
phpMyAdmin79687797.7
Oracle Enterprise Manager97788788.0
Navicat Essentials78687787.5
Aqua Data Studio88788777.8
DBeaver88788798.0

Which Database Administration Tool Is Right for You?

Solo / Freelancer

phpMyAdmin or DBeaver provides free, open-source tools for single developers or small teams managing MySQL, MariaDB, or multi-database environments.

SMB

Navicat Essentials or SQL Server Management Studio simplifies administration for small teams with a limited number of databases.

Mid-Market

Navicat Premium, DBArtisan, or Oracle SQL Developer offers multi-database support, backup automation, and performance monitoring.

Enterprise

Toad for Oracle, Oracle Enterprise Manager, and Aqua Data Studio provide enterprise-grade monitoring, administration, and analytics for large-scale environments.

Budget vs Premium

Open-source or lightweight tools are cost-effective for SMBs. Enterprise solutions provide advanced automation, analytics, and integration at higher costs.

Feature Depth vs Ease of Use

Enterprise tools offer deep features but may require training; SMB-friendly solutions balance usability with essential administrative capabilities.

Integrations & Scalability

Enterprise tools integrate with cloud services, DevOps pipelines, and ITSM systems. SMB tools scale for small to mid-size deployments.

Security & Compliance Needs

Tools with SSL/TLS support, role-based access, and audit capabilities are recommended for compliance with GDPR, SOC 2, ISO 27001, and HIPAA.


Frequently Asked Questions (FAQs)

1. What is a database administration tool?

Itโ€™s software that helps DBAs manage, maintain, and optimize databases efficiently, handling backups, security, performance, and user management.

2. Can small teams use enterprise tools?

Yes, but lightweight or free tools like SSMS, phpMyAdmin, or DBeaver are more cost-effective for small teams.

3. What databases are supported?

Most tools support SQL Server, Oracle, MySQL, PostgreSQL, and some support NoSQL or cloud databases.

4. How do these tools improve performance?

They monitor queries, track resource usage, optimize indexes, and provide alerts on slow queries or bottlenecks.

5. Are these tools secure?

Enterprise tools offer role-based access, SSL/TLS encryption, and auditing; open-source tools rely on system security.

6. Can they integrate with DevOps pipelines?

Yes, many provide APIs or connectors to automate administrative tasks within CI/CD workflows.

7. Do they support cloud databases?

Yes, most modern tools support cloud-native or hybrid deployments.

8. How easy is setup?

Cloud-native and open-source tools are easy to deploy; enterprise solutions may require specialized setup.

9. Do they support backups and restores?

Yes, most provide backup, restore, and scheduling features to ensure database availability.

10. Can they monitor multiple databases simultaneously?

Enterprise and multi-database tools like Navicat Premium and DBArtisan support monitoring and managing multiple databases.

Conclusion

Database Administration Tools are essential for maintaining the health, security, and performance of relational, NoSQL, and cloud databases. Selection depends on organizational size, database types, cloud adoption, and operational complexity. SMBs benefit from lightweight tools like SSMS, phpMyAdmin, or DBeaver, while mid-market and enterprise organizations may require Navicat Premium, Toad for Oracle, or Oracle Enterprise Manager for advanced administration, automation, and analytics. Open-source tools offer flexibility and cost savings, while enterprise-grade tools provide comprehensive features for performance tuning, backup automation, and multi-database management. Recommended next steps are to shortlist suitable tools, pilot them in controlled environments, and validate performance, integration, and compliance requirements before full deployment.

Subscribe
Notify of
guest
0 Comments
Oldest
Newest Most Voted
Inline Feedbacks
View all comments
0
Would love your thoughts, please comment.x
()
x